Early Explorations and Spiritual Influences
Before his prominent role at the Bauhaus, Itten's artistic journey was marked by significant spiritual and philosophical explorations. His involvement with Mazdaznan, an ancient Persian philosophy emphasizing diet, breathing exercises, and meditation, deeply informed his early work. This spiritual quest often manifested in abstract compositions that predated his more structured Bauhaus period. These early works, though perhaps less overtly geometric, reveal a profound interest in cosmic order and inner experience. They are characterized by a more fluid brushwork and a search for visual representations of spiritual energy.
Consider works from his pre-Bauhaus years, such as those created during his time in Vienna or his early Paris experiments. These pieces often feature dynamic interplay of forms and colors, reflecting an intuitive approach to composition rather than a strictly theoretical one. Discovering these earlier Johannes Itten art examples is crucial for understanding the roots of his later, more systematic approach to color and form. They highlight his journey from an expressive artist to a rigorous theorist, without ever losing his intrinsic connection to the emotional power of color.
Beyond the Bauhaus Canon: Experimental Studies
While Itten's Bauhaus work is celebrated for its clarity and pedagogical intent, many of his experimental studies and preparatory works remain less publicized. These are not always finished paintings but rather visual diaries of his thought process. They might be intricate pencil sketches exploring form, gouache studies testing color relationships, or mixed-media pieces pushing the boundaries of texture and material. These studies are invaluable as they show Itten's iterative process and his constant questioning of visual perception.
For example, some of his "Rythmus" drawings or smaller scale collages, which may not have been intended for public display, offer direct insight into his method. These works demonstrate how he meticulously built up his understanding of contrast, rhythm, and tension within a composition. Late Works: A Synthesis of Form and Spirit
After his departure from the Bauhaus, Itten continued to create art that synthesized his foundational theories with a renewed spiritual depth. His later works, particularly from the 1950s and 60s, often exhibit a rich complexity, moving beyond the stark contrasts of his early Bauhaus period into a more nuanced exploration of color and light. These pieces sometimes feature circular or spherical motifs, representing cosmic unity and the integration of opposites.
These later compositions might incorporate a softer palette or more intricate layering of color fields, reflecting a mature artist's contemplation. While some of his most famous works are from the Bauhaus era, these later, more introspective pieces are also significant. They represent the culmination of a lifetime dedicated to understanding the universal language of art.
